Abstract
Polymer–Protein Hybrids Polymer–protein hybrids provide a new route for protein stabilization in harsh environments. In article number 2201809, Michael A. Webb, Adam J. Gormley, and co-workers demonstrate a strategy combining automated polymer synthesis and machine learning to design copolymers tailored to enhance the stability of target proteins. This strategy may overcome challenges and accelerate development associated with utilizing proteins in industrial and medical applications.
